목록분류 전체보기 (80)
스터디 용 블로그
3항 연산자3항 연산자는 if else로 해결할 수 있지만, 이보다 더 간편이 사용할 수 있는 장점이 있기 때문에 가끔 쓰이곤 한다. 만일 int형 변수 a, b가 있고 b가 5보다 클 경우 a에 5를 넣고, 아닐경우 a에 b를 넣고싶다면a = b > 5 ? 5 : b; 와 같이 넣어주면 된다 할당할 곳 = 비교문? 참일때값 : 거짓일때 값
Html 파일에서 contentType에 따른 File Type...이걸 이용해서 File download가 가능하다.. application/acad AutoCAD drawing files dwg application/clariscad ClarisCAD files ccad application/dxf DXF (AutoCAD) dxf application/msaccess Microsoft Access file mdb application/msword Microsoft Word file doc application/octet-stream Uninterpreted binary bin application/pdf PDF (Adobe Acrobat) pdf application/postscript PostScr..
Response는 클라이언트로 돌려보낼 놈입니다. 이 정보를 분석해서 브라우저는 화면을 출력합니다. 일반적으로 Response 객체의 출력 스트림(보통 Writer)을 사용하여 HTML(아니면 다른 타입의 컨텐츠)을 작성합니다. Response 객체에는 I/O 출력 이외에 다른 메소드들도 있습니다. ServletResponse
http://hsj0511.tistory.com/205
http://rocabilly.tistory.com/27
Ajax가 필요한 일이 발생해서, 급조해서 Ajax를 공부했다.공부한 책은 Ajax 입문이며, 처음 약 5~60 페이지만 읽었다. 급조한 내용이니 너무 신뢰하지 말 것. 아.. 그리고 이 책, 중대한 오탈자가 은근히 있다. 혹시 이 책으로 공부하고자 한다면 오탈자를 확인한 뒤에 공부해서 불필요한 시간 낭비를 줄이는 것이 좋겠다.아무튼, 책의 내용중 Ajax의 기본적인 사용에 관한 문제를 정리하고, 또 JSP/Servlet 엔진에서 Ajax사용시에 발생하는 한글 인코딩(encoding)문제의 처리방법도 정리해 둔다.Ajax의 개념에 관한 설명은 인터넷 상에 차고 넘치므로 생략.* A Simpler Ajax Path가 Ajax 입문에 좋은 글. Ajax의 개발 순서 1. XMLHttpRequest 객체 생성..
http://www.nextree.co.kr/p9521/
초보입니다.DAO랑 service랑 차이가 없던데 무슨차이죠? 아래는 소스입니다. package test.dao; import java.util.List; import test.web.dto.BoardDTO; public interface BoardDAO { public BoardDTO getBoard(String accno) throws Exception; public List getBoardList() throws Exception; public String insertBoard(BoardDTO boardDTO) throws Exception; public void updateBoard(BoardDTO boardDTO) throws Exception; } package test.service; imp..
MVC pattern 을 말씀하시는것 같은데요. 이중 사용되는 패턴의 일부중 VO 또는 DAO 를 사용합니다. MVC 는 가장 기본적으로 JSP 를 사용하신다고 할경우 사용자 화면에 해당하는 JSP 그리고 서버쪽 Servlet 그리고 DataBase 단 DAO 로 나뉩니다. 그리고 JSP Servlet DataBase 등에 데이터를 주고 받는데 있어서 데이터 타입별로 VO 를 사용합니다. VO 는 가는데마다 이름이 조금씩 다를수 있습니다. 어디서는 DTO 라고 부르기도 하구요. Value Object 라고 해서 VO 라고 알고 있구요. DTO 가 Data Template Object 인가 정확하지는 않으니까 찾아보시죠. DAO 는 DataBase 부분에 쿼리 부분과 쿼리에서 나온 결과값을 VO 에 담아서..
nano memo.txt : memo.txt를 편집하기 위해 open한다.•nano -B memo.txt : save 직전에 이전 파일을 ~.filename으로 백업한다.•nano -m memo.txt : cursor 이동을 위해 mouse를 사용한다. (지원시)•nano +83 memo.txt : 83번째줄 부터 편집한다. -m 옵션은 mouse 사용을 위해 사용됩니다. mouse로 text 선택, 그리고 이동이 가능합니다. 처음 클릭한 이후 의도하지 않았던 text의 block 선택이 되기도 합니다. JOE와 마찬가지로 타이핑부터 시작됩니다. 방향키로 cursor를 이동시킬 수 있으며, del, backspace, enter 키 사용이 가능합니다. ctrl+g를 눌러 도움말을 볼 수 있습니다.•ctr..